Written exam for Bar Council enrollment held

BSS
Published On: 28 Jun 2025, 20:19

DHAKA, June 28, 2025 (BSS) - The written examination for lawyer enrollment 
under the Bangladesh Bar Council was held today from 9 am to 1 pm across 17 
centers, including 11 on the Dhaka University (DU) campus.

To ensure smooth conduct of the examination, 50 judicial magistrates were 
deployed at the centers. Additionally, five substitute magistrates were kept 
on standby to step in if any assigned officers were unable to perform their 
duties due to unavoidable circumstances.

A total of 13,258 candidates who passed the Bar Council's previous MCQ exam 
took part in this written examination, alongside those who were unsuccessful 
in the last written test.

It is worth noting that aspiring lawyers must pass a three-stage examination 
process-- MCQ, written and Viva (oral examination)-- administered by the 
Bangladesh Bar Council to receive official enrollment certification.
